<!DOCTYPE HTML> <html> <!-- SECTION: Man Pages --> <head> <link rel="stylesheet" type="text/css" href="../cups-printable.css"> <title>lpc(8)</title> </head> <body> <h1 class="title">lpc(8)</h1> <h2 class="title"><a name="NAME">Name</a></h2> lpc - line printer control program (deprecated) <h2 class="title"><a name="SYNOPSIS">Synopsis</a></h2> <b>lpc</b> [ <i>command</i> [ <i>parameter(s)</i> ] ] <h2 class="title"><a name="DESCRIPTION">Description</a></h2> <b>lpc</b> provides limited control over printer and class queues provided by CUPS. It can also be used to query the state of queues. <p>If no command is specified on the command-line, <b>lpc</b> displays a prompt and accepts commands from the standard input. <h3><a name="COMMANDS">Commands</a></h3> The <b>lpc</b> program accepts a subset of commands accepted by the Berkeley <b>lpc</b> program of the same name: <dl class="man"> <dt><b>exit</b> <dd style="margin-left: 5.0em">Exits the command interpreter. <dt><b>help </b>[<i>command</i>] <dd style="margin-left: 5.0em"><dt><b>? </b>[<i>command</i>] <dd style="margin-left: 5.0em">Displays a short help message. <dt><b>quit</b> <dd style="margin-left: 5.0em">Exits the command interpreter. <dt><b>status </b>[<i>queue</i>] <dd style="margin-left: 5.0em">Displays the status of one or more printer or class queues. </dl> <h2 class="title"><a name="NOTES">Notes</a></h2> This program is deprecated and will be removed in a future feature release of CUPS. <p>Since <b>lpc</b> is geared towards the Berkeley printing system, it is impossible to use <b>lpc</b> to configure printer or class queues provided by CUPS. To configure printer or class queues you must use the <b>lpadmin</b>(8) command or another CUPS-compatible client with that functionality. <h2 class="title"><a name="SEE_ALSO">See Also</a></h2> <b>cancel</b>(1), <b>cupsaccept</b>(8), <b>cupsenable</b>(8), <b>lp</b>(1), <b>lpadmin</b>(8), <b>lpr</b>(1), <b>lprm</b>(1), <b>lpstat</b>(1), CUPS Online Help (<a href="http://localhost:631/help">http://localhost:631/help</a>) <h2 class="title"><a name="COPYRIGHT">Copyright</a></h2> Copyright © 2007-2019 by Apple Inc. </body> </html>
